The IVF/ICSI process includes ovarian stimulation, egg retrieval, laboratory fertilization (with ICSI for sperm injection), and embryo transfer. Our specialists monitor progress throughout and provide post-transfer support, maximizing your chances for a successful pregnancy.

What is the difference between IVF and ICSI?
In-Vitro Fertilization (IVF) involves combining eggs and sperm in a lab to create embryos, which are then transferred into the uterus.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I) is an advanced form of IVF where a single sperm is injected directly into an egg to improve fertilization chances, especially in cases of male infertility. Who can benefit from IVF or ICSI treatment?
In-Vitro Fertilization (IVF) / ICSI are suitable for couples with infertility, same-sex partners, and single parents using donor eggs or sperm. It’s also recommended for patients with blocked fallopian tubes, unexplained infertility, or those pursuing fertility treatment after cancer. How many IVF cycles are typically needed for success?
The number of IVF cycles needed for success varies by age, egg quality, and overall health. Many patients conceive within one to three cycles, while others may need additional rounds.
